The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) scores providers 0–100 across four performance categories: Quality, Cost, Promoting Interoperability, and Improvement Activities, weighted under 42 CFR §414.1380. Reporting is voluntary for many small practices, so absence of a MIPS score is not a quality signal.

Board certification through an ABMS or AOA member board signals voluntary post-licensure examination plus continuous Maintenance of Certification cycles. Verify any individual provider's status through certificationmatters.org (ABMS) or osteopathic.org (AOA).

Ashley Brown, MD appears in the CMS NPPES registry as a Dermatology Physician provider holding MD credentials at 3810 SPRINGHURST BLVD STE 200, Louisville, KY, 40241, with a listed phone of (502) 583-1749. NPI 1376962860 was issued on 04/10/2014. Because NPPES data is self-reported by the provider and refreshed monthly, the address, phone, and specialty reflect what Brown most recently submitted to CMS rather than a vetted directory listing, which is why patients should always confirm the practice is still at this location before scheduling.

Medicare Part D records for calendar year 2023 show 1,165 prescription claims written by this provider, covering 396 Medicare beneficiaries and totaling roughly $173K in drug spend, split 5% brand-name and 95% generic by claim count. These figures capture only Medicare Part D, commercial insurance, Medicaid, and cash-pay prescriptions are not included, and any drug-beneficiary cell under 11 is suppressed by CMS for patient privacy. On the CMS Merit-based Incentive Payment System, this provider earned a Final Score of 62.1/100 for the 2023 performance year (Quality 61, Cost 96.2), compared with the national average of 83.1.

Dermatology Physician is a mid-sized specialty nationwide, with 14,610 enrolled providers across 53 states and an average of 729 Part D claims per prescriber, so the context for interpreting these metrics differs meaningfully from a primary-care baseline. The federal Physician Payments Sunshine Act (part of the Affordable Care Act) requires drug and medical-device manufacturers + group purchasing organizations to publicly report payments and other transfers of value to physicians and teaching hospitals. Industry payments are not necessarily indicators of bias, they include research funding, consulting fees for evidence-based work, royalties for inventions, food at conferences, and similar items. The disclosure exists for transparency. Read our methodology for how we interpret this data.
